Do I need previous guitar experience?
No. The main path begins with posture, tuning language, open strings, and simple chord shapes.
What kind of guitar should I use?
A playable steel-string acoustic with comfortable action is a good starting point. A music shop can help check setup and fit.
How much should I practice?
Start with ten to twenty focused minutes several times per week. Consistency matters more than long, exhausting sessions.
